如何优化网站数据库性能以提高用户体验?
时间:2024-11-20 浏览:14
优化网站数据库性能并提升用户体验可以通过以下几个方面进行:

1. 数据库设计和优化

    -规范化:

确保数据库设计遵循基本的规范化原则(如第一范式、第二范式等),以减少数据冗余,提高查询效率。

    -索引使用:

合理添加索引来加速查询过程。对经常用于查询条件的字段建立索引可以大大提升查询速度。

    -查询优化:

避免在SELECT语句中使用不必要或复杂的子查询和联接操作。优化SQL语句,确保其执行效率高。

2. 数据库维护

    -定期分析和优化:

定期运行数据库的分析工具(如MySQL的EXPLAIN计划),检查慢查询并进行调整。

    -内存管理:

合理设置缓冲池、缓存策略等,提升数据读写速度。例如,在MySQL中调整`innodb_buffer_pool_size`参数以优化缓存性能。

3. 数据库服务器配置

    -硬件升级:

根据数据库负载情况,适当增加服务器的存储容量和CPU/内存资源。

    -负载均衡:

使用负载均衡技术分散查询请求到多个数据库实例或服务器,提高系统响应速度和稳定性。

4. 数据库性能监控与分析

    -实时监控:

利用工具(如Prometheus、Grafana等)进行数据库性能监控,及时发现并解决瓶颈问题。

    -日志分析:

定期分析数据库日志(如慢查询日志),了解哪些操作耗时长,并针对性优化。

5. 第三方平台选择 关于“三优云个saas建站服务平台”的推荐:

1.安全性:

三优云提供安全可靠的服务,确保您的网站数据在传输和存储过程中得到充分保护。通过使用HTTPS、SSL证书等技术,可以有效地防止数据泄露。

2.可靠性:

作为SaaS服务提供商,三优云通常有成熟的基础设施和运维团队,能够提供稳定的运行环境和服务支持,避免了自建服务器带来的维护压力。

3.便捷性:

借助三优云的服务,您无需投入大量资源在硬件采购、软件部署和日常管理上。只需关注网站内容的更新与优化即可,大大节省时间和成本。

4.可扩展性:

随着业务增长,三优云可以提供灵活的升级方案,帮助您的网站轻松应对访问量的增加,确保用户体验不受影响。 通过上述措施和选择可靠的建站服务平台(如“三优云个saas建站服务平台”),您可以显著提升网站的数据库性能与用户体验。结合合理的资源配置、优化的数据管理策略和专业的技术支持,将助力您的在线项目取得成功
code